Transaction 311ff0d708d276cf3f59ec9716cceaefe09829ace0ec9b571165ecc89e797ad3

3 Input
1 Outputs
  • 311ff0d708d276cf3f59ec9716cceaefe09829ace0ec9b571165ecc89e797ad3:0
  • value  59497026
    address  3BMEX5gGRU993dJkVoHLtSdmrvqKbrepXE